Role Overview
This is a hands-on producer-and-host position for a fast-growing Nairobi drinks brand. You will design, build, and run a rolling calendar of branded events—from live-band nights and silent disco sunsets to games nights and curated socials—making sure each one feels intentional, premium, and unforgettable. Beyond the night itself, your job is to turn every event into earned word of mouth and shareable content that keeps the brand in the city’s conversation long after the last guest leaves.
Key Responsibilities
- Own the full event lifecycle: concept, venue negotiation, production, on-the-night hosting, and post-event follow-through.
- Plan and deliver 4–5 branded events per month once ramped, weaving them into a coherent year-long story rather than a series of disconnected dates.
- Partner with the Content Creation Lead and their team so every event is captured live and repurposed into content that extends the night beyond the room.
- Scout and secure high-capacity, high-energy venues in Nairobi, then convert those relationships into stocked listings alongside the Nairobi Sales Lead—targeting 6–8 new stocked venues per quarter.
- Oversee the in-market sampling campaign: coordinate activations, prepare materials, and train every sampling staff member to the brand’s standard before they head out.
- Maintain a strict premium bar across every touchpoint, with all creative and brand elements signed off by management before going live.
- Manage each event budget with owner-level discipline, spending within an agreed per-event limit and escalating anything above that to the CEO.
Requirements & Qualifications
- Proven end-to-end experience producing live events or experiential activations.
- A real, working network across Nairobi’s venues, nightlife, music, and creative scenes—people pick up when you call.
- Strong hosting instincts: you can hold a room, read a crowd, and keep energy high even when things go sideways.
- A self-starting, owner mentality—you don’t wait for instruction and you take responsibility for outcomes.
- Premium taste and meticulous attention to detail, refusing to ship anything mediocre.
- Willingness to work nights, weekends, and travel to the coast when an event justifies it.
- A valid driving license or reliable personal transport.
- Preferred: existing relationships with venue and bar owners; FMCG or trade experience with brand stocking; experience managing sampling teams; a natural instinct for content capture; drinks or hospitality background.
